What is Mesothelioma?

Mesothelioma is an uncommon cancerous disease, develops in an extremely thin layer of tissues that covers our organs. The symptoms of mesothelioma usually don't manifest until the disease has reached an advanced stage. Shortness of breath, chest discomfort or a dry throat are typically the first signs.

The main reason for mesothelioma is asbestos exposure. Certain industries' workers are at a higher exposure risk, such as those working at shipyards, construction sites and factories, power plants mines, factories, and other factories. Plumbers (asbestos is used in pipe insulation) roofing contractors as well as electricians, drywallers and roofers are also at risk.

The diagnosis of mesothelioma can be devastating, but there are treatments available. Treatment options include chemotherapy, surgery or radiation therapy. Mesothelioma Treatment

The kind of treatment that a patient receives for mesothelioma is contingent upon the stage of cancer and location and other factors. Doctors who treat mesothelioma usually combine treatments such as surgery, chemo radiation therapy, immunotherapy.

Mesothelioma typically occurs in the tissues that line the chest cavity and lungs and is known as the pleura. Other rare forms of Mesothelioma could be found in the peritoneum. This is the membrane that runs along the abdominal cavity and around the testicles and the heart.

Because mesothelioma can cause symptoms similar to those triggered by other lung diseases and conditions, it can be difficult for a doctor to diagnose. To determine if you may have mesothelioma the doctor will conduct a physical exam and ask about your medical history. Your doctor can also request imaging tests like a CT scan or Xray, or a biopsy to confirm the diagnosis. A biopsy is when a small piece of mesothelioma-affected tissue is removed for examination under a microscope. This is done with VATS (Video assisted thoracoscopic Surgery) it is a kind of keyhole surgery.

If the cancer is detected in its earliest stages doctors can remove the affected lung or pleura in surgery. This is known as active or curative treatment for mesothelioma. The later stages of mesothelioma can be more difficult to treat.

In addition to the surgery and other mesothelioma treatment options doctors may recommend palliative treatment to control symptoms like shortness of breath or pain. They could also insert an incision in your chest to remove fluid from the pleura or put you on a pump to drain your stomach.
